K7LiSi8 is a lithium silicate ceramic compound belonging to the family of engineered silicate ceramics. This material is primarily investigated in research contexts for applications requiring lightweight ceramic structures with thermal and chemical stability characteristics typical of lithium-containing silicate systems. The addition of lithium to silicate networks is known to modify thermal expansion, chemical durability, and processing behavior, making such compositions candidates for specialized applications where conventional silicates are inadequate.
